POSTAL CARDS: 1909 Scenic Issue Adelaide Printing with '...AUSTRALIA.' (with dot) 'SAVINGS BANK' in purple brown, with a row of bicycles & an early automobile, unused.
POSTAL CARDS: 1909 Scenic Issue Adelaide Printing with '...AUSTRALIA.' (with dot) 'DAIRY FARM/NEAR ADELAIDE' in crimson, very minor stain on the reverse, unused.
POSTAL CARDS: 1909 Scenic Issue Adelaide Printing with '...AUSTRALIA .' (with dot) 1d 'WORLD'S RECORD. 1992lbs, DRESSED' (Bull) in blue, a couple of very minor blemishes, unused. [A used example sold at our auction of 30.8.2020 for $479]
POSTAL CARDS: 1909 Scenic Issue Melbourne Printing with '...AUSTRALIA ' (no dot) 1d 'CARTING - FAR NORTH' (team of bullocks) in dull blue, unused. Superb!
POSTAL CARDS: 1909 Scenic Issue Melbourne Printing with '...AUSTRALIA ' (no dot) 1d 'CHAMPION/SHORTHORN' (bull) in blue-grey, minor discolouration on the address panel, unused. The Holy Grail of South Australian postal stationery: only five examples recorded & only the second unused example we have seen. [Nelson Eustis' used example sold in 2003 for $1165. Another used example sold at our auction of 30.8.2020 for $1617. That price caused the owner of the cards in this section to send this example for sale]
